Groundhog Day Cupcakes

Description

These adorable Groundhog Day Cupcakes are a fun way to celebrate the iconic day! With chocolate cupcakes topped with creamy frosting and a little groundhog design, they’re sure to bring a smile to anyone who enjoys this whimsical tradition. Perfect for parties or a themed dessert!


Ingredients

Scale

For the Cupcakes:

  • 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 1/2 cup cocoa powder
  • 1 1/2 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1/2 cup vegetable oil
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1/2 cup boiling water

For the Frosting:

  • 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 4 cups powdered sugar
  • 1/4 cup cocoa powder
  • 2 tbsp heavy cream (or milk)
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• Pinch of salt

For Decoration (Groundhog Design):

  • 1/2 cup mini chocolate chips (for eyes)
  • 1/2 cup crushed graham crackers (for the ground)
  • 1/2 cup orange fondant (or orange-colored candy) for the nose
  • 12 pretzel sticks (for paws)

Instructions

  1. For the Cupcakes:

    1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a 12-cup muffin tin with cupcake liners.
    2. In a large bowl, combine the flour, sugar, cocoa powder,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. Whisk until well blended.
    3. In a separate bowl, beat the eggs, milk, oil, and vanilla extract together until smooth.
    4. Add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ients and mix until just combined.
    5. Gradually add the boiling water to the batter, mixing until smooth. The batter will be thin, which is normal.
    6. Pour the batter evenly into the cupcake liners, filling each about 2/3 full.
    7. Bake for 18-20 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
    8. Allow the cupcakes to cool in the pan for 5 min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.

    For the Frosting:

    1. In a large bowl, beat the softened butter with an electric mixer on medium speed until creamy.
    2. Gradually add the powdered sugar, cocoa powder, heavy cream, vanilla extract, and a pinch of salt.
    3. Continue to beat on high speed until the frosting is light and fluffy, about 2-3 minutes.

    For the Groundhog Design:

    1. Once the cupcakes are completely cooled, frost each with a generous amount of the chocolate frosting.
    2. Gently press a layer of crushed graham crackers into the frosting around the edges of the cupcake to create the “ground.”
    3. For the groundhog, create a small mound of frosting in the center of the cupcake.
    4. Use the mini chocolate chips for the eyes, and mold a small piece of orange fondant or candy into a tiny triangle for the nose.
    5. Attach the pretzel sticks on each side of the mound for paws.
    6. Optionally, use additional frosting to create little ears or a tail.

Notes

  • You can also make the groundhog’s face out of frosting using a piping bag and different colored icing.
  • If you want a fun twist, you could make the cupcakes chocolate with a hidden surprise inside (such as a small chocolate truffle or candy) for an extra layer of fun.
  • Store leftover cupcakes in an airtight container for up to 2-3 days.
